stile1

 
Pronunciation: /stʌɪl/

noun

  • an arrangement of steps that allows people but not animals to climb over a fence or wall.

Origin:

Old English stigel, from a Germanic root meaning 'to climb'

Do not confuse stile with style. Stile means 'steps set into a fence or wall for people to climb over', whereas style means 'a way of doing something' ( different styles of management).
